About The Position

The Chicago Park District’s Summer Legal Intern Program provides opportunities for law students to work on substantive legal assignments under the supervision of a Park District attorney. Performs related duties as required. 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ITY: Perform legal research and draft legal memoranda; draft motions; review discovery; prepare for and attend depositions and court hearings; draft and review contracts and other legal documents in a variety of practice areas, including but not limited to personal injury, labor and employment, procurement, real estate and municipal financing; and participate in other litigation or transactional matters as assigned. Work in a professional environment, building workplace skills and gaining valuable experience in preparation for future employment. A law student with a license under Supreme Court Rule 711 may appear before the court under the supervision of a Park District attorney.
